 I had ordered a tweed winter hat that was supposed to be made in the UK. From a website with the address "fablifecoaching.co.uk". I figured UK website, UK hat it must be legit. So I placed the order which was £21.99 with £9.99 shipping to the U.S.. This was a little cheaper than most sites, but I didn't think anything of it. It ended up being about $50.00. So I received a tracking number and it showed that the package was coming from China. At this point I knew I was scammed, but still trying to be optimistic. The package showed up and sure enough it contained a paper hat. The tag inside said two things "100% paper" and "China". So I emailed there customer service and looked at their return and exchange policy. I followed the exchange policy instructions and sent pictures and a description, wanting to send back the hat I got and find out what happened to the hat I ordered. I did not receive an email back for about a week and I had sent 3 during that time. When I did get an email back it said "hi, so sorry our manager can't agree that, as we have spent a lot of shipping fee and item cost, so we hope u can accept 10% of your order amount, thx." Which, sounds like some stereotypical broken English from a Chinese person. So I called my credit card company and they're sending me a fraud report form and will apparently be removing this charge.
